Abstract

This study investigates the variation of address terms that occurs in a movie “Avatar: The Way of Water“. The focus of the study is to find the type of address terms and its social factors. In addition, the study uses (Wardhaugh, 2006) theory of address term and (Holmes, 2012) theory of social factors term to assist the writer in comprehending and analyzing the data obtained from the movie. The descriptive qualitative method is used for the research design. The data analyzed was in the form of a conversation taken from the movie by describing and interpreting each context of the data. Based on analysis, the writer found 26 data of address terms which categorized into 7 types of address terms First Name (FN), Last Name (LN), Title plus Last Name (TLN), title only (T), Pet Name (PN). Kinship (K), and lastly Mockery (M). It shows that Mockery is the most common address term in the “Avatar : The Way of Water” movie. There are several social factors that influence the variation of address terms. Each of them has different strengths to give impact in the choice of address term. It can be seen that the social distance scale is the most influential social factor in the use of address terms.
